我在IE11和我编写的静态javascript类上遇到了一些麻烦。

我得到的错误是:



指向:

// ===========================================
// RGMUI BOX
// Static class

class RgMuiBox {
^

所以我猜我在以错误的方式定义此类?正确的做法是什么?

我在SO上找到了一篇帖子,似乎指出问题是ES5 vs ES6-我认为IE11不支持ES6?

只是为了完整,这就是我(简化)的内容:
class RgMuiBox {
    static method1() {
    // .. code ..
    }
}

谢谢!

最佳答案

讨厌重新打开这样一个旧问题,但结果仍然显示很高,因此,我将添加发现的内容:

要重申@Mikey和@REJH所说的,IE11无法识别类。

就是说,像Babel这样的工具将使您可以将类转换为可在IE11上运行的内容。

10-04 22:28
查看更多